我们知道,对多进程的程序而言。如果子进程结束后父进程还未结束,那么该子进程将会处于僵尸状态,我们称之为“僵进程”。对于僵进程,直到父进程调用wait()或waitpid()函数后,僵进程的状态才会被解除,此时子进程的资源才得以释放。
继续阅读“Linux线程的连接和分离”
学而不思则罔,思而不学则殆。
我们知道,对多进程的程序而言。如果子进程结束后父进程还未结束,那么该子进程将会处于僵尸状态,我们称之为“僵进程”。对于僵进程,直到父进程调用wait()或waitpid()函数后,僵进程的状态才会被解除,此时子进程的资源才得以释放。
继续阅读“Linux线程的连接和分离”